Paris informed Moscow of Mistral ships' sale to Egypt - Russian deputy prime minister
France kept Russia updated on the course of negotiations concerning the sale of the Mistral-class helicopter carriers, originally built for Russia, to Egypt, Russian Deputy Prime Minister Dmitry Rogozin wrote on his Twitter account on Thursday.
"I confirm that the French side kept us updated on the course of the talks with its partners concerning the sale of the Mistral-type amphibious assault ships," he said.
Kremlin spokesman Dmitry Peskov said earlier that Russia's interests had been taken into consideration during France's Mistral sale talks with Egypt.
